The National Education Policy 2020 is the latest reform policy introduced by the Government of India to modernize the education system and align its outcome to the changing trends in the world. This policy was approved by the Union Cabinet of India on 29 July 2020 and the first phase of implementation began on 1st April 2022. For India to become a developed country in the next 25 years, the Indian economy needs to grow at a radical speed. And for that, it needs gen-next reforms and must take drastic steps toward human development. It is a fact that the education system of a country is at the heart of human development. So, the change needs to be first implemented here. With this vision, NEP 2020 has proposed to revamp the archaic education system that has prevailed in our country for so long. One major reform proposition of NEP 2020 is to take a holistic multidisciplinary approach to education. There has been considerable debate and discussion in the education world regarding the best way of teaching. The new world problems are unique and extremely complex, however, the solutions to these problems cannot be simple. It requires innovative thinkers who can look at the problem from all perspectives and provide solutions. NEP 2020 intends to develop the key skills required to create innovative thinkers, resolute solution providers, and passionate change-makers by taking a holistic approach to teaching. This paper will discuss the role of NEP 2020 in nurturing Holistic Multidisciplinary education and its impact. It will also enlist challenges that are likely to be experienced during the process and provide recommendations thereof.
